Assess regulatory requirements
Before launching HealthGear Essentials and offering medical equipment to healthcare providers and patients, it is essential to assess the regulatory requirements that govern the medical equipment industry. Compliance with these regulations is crucial to ensure the safety and effectiveness of the equipment being provided, as well as to avoid any legal issues that could arise from non-compliance.
Regulatory Bodies: The medical equipment industry is heavily regulated by various government agencies and regulatory bodies to ensure that products meet specific standards for quality, safety, and efficacy. In the United States, the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) is the primary regulatory authority responsible for overseeing medical devices.
Classification of Medical Devices: Medical devices are categorized into different classes based on the level of risk they pose to patients. Class I devices are considered low-risk, while Class II and Class III devices are higher-risk and require more stringent regulatory controls. It is important to determine the classification of the medical equipment being offered by HealthGear Essentials to understand the regulatory requirements that apply.
Quality Management Systems: Implementing a quality management system is essential for ensuring that the medical equipment meets regulatory standards. HealthGear Essentials should establish processes for design control, risk management, and post-market surveillance to maintain the quality and safety of the products being offered.
Labeling and Packaging Requirements: Medical devices must be properly labeled and packaged to provide essential information to users and healthcare providers. HealthGear Essentials should ensure that all labeling and packaging comply with regulatory requirements, including instructions for use, warnings, and precautions.
Post-Market Surveillance: Monitoring the performance of medical devices after they have been placed on the market is crucial for identifying any potential safety issues or adverse events. HealthGear Essentials should establish procedures for collecting and analyzing post-market data to ensure the ongoing safety and effectiveness of the equipment.
Training and Education: Healthcare providers and patients who use medical equipment must be properly trained on how to use the devices safely and effectively. HealthGear Essentials should offer training programs and educational materials to ensure that users have the knowledge and skills necessary to use the equipment correctly.
By assessing and complying with regulatory requirements, HealthGear Essentials can ensure that its medical equipment meets the necessary standards for quality, safety, and efficacy. This commitment to regulatory compliance will not only protect the business from legal risks but also build trust with healthcare providers and patients who rely on the equipment for their care.

Determine funding sources
Securing funding is a critical step in launching and growing a business, especially in the competitive healthcare industry. For HealthGear Essentials, identifying the right funding sources will be essential to support the development and expansion of our medical equipment business. Here are some key considerations for determining funding sources:
Bootstrapping: One option for funding the initial stages of HealthGear Essentials is through bootstrapping, using personal savings or revenue generated from early sales. This approach allows for greater control over the business without taking on external debt or giving up equity.
Angel Investors: Seeking investment from angel investors who specialize in healthcare or medical technology can provide not only financial support but also valuable industry expertise and connections. Angel investors are typically high-net-worth individuals who invest in early-stage companies in exchange for equity.
Venture Capital: Venture capital firms may also be a potential funding source for HealthGear Essentials as we look to scale our operations and reach a larger market. Venture capitalists provide funding in exchange for equity and often look for high-growth potential in the businesses they invest in.
Small Business Loans: Another option for funding could be securing small business loans from banks or other financial institutions. These loans can provide the necessary capital to purchase inventory, equipment, or cover operational expenses.
Crowdfunding: Crowdfunding platforms can be a creative way to raise funds for HealthGear Essentials by tapping into a larger pool of potential investors or customers. Crowdfunding campaigns can generate interest and support for the business while raising capital.
Grants and Government Funding: Researching and applying for grants or government funding programs that support healthcare innovation and small business development can also be a viable funding source for HealthGear Essentials. These funds may come with specific requirements or restrictions but can provide valuable financial support.
By carefully considering and exploring these funding sources, HealthGear Essentials can secure the necessary capital to launch, grow, and succeed in the competitive medical equipment market. It is essential to evaluate the pros and cons of each funding option and choose the ones that align best with the business goals and financial needs of the company.
